Flu Complications


The most common complications are viral or bacterial lung, nasal cavity, middle ear inflammation, chronic non-infectious diseases, and rebound, exacerbation. Less common flu complications are heart muscle, brain, nerve inflammation, which can be fatal.
Flu is 7th leading cause of death in 1999 and 2000.
In the USA around 20,000 – 40,000 people die each year from flu complications, in the UK this number is slightly lower with around 4,500 deaths anually, but this number rises to about 12,000 during the flu epidemic.
